ZOXAMIDE
Synonym(s):3,5-Dichloro-N-(3-chloro-1-ethyl-1-methyl-2-oxopropyl)-4-methylbenzamide
- CAS NO.:156052-68-5
- Empirical Formula: C14H16Cl3NO2
- Molecular Weight: 336.64
- MDL number: MFCD03792722

What is ZOXAMIDE?
The Uses of ZOXAMIDE
Zoxamide is a fungacide for control of mildew and late bight. Zoxamide was developped for foliar use on potatoes, vines, and vegetables. Zoxamide is able to specifically target Oomycete fungi; Zoxamid e exhibits strong preventive activity combined with excellent rainfast and residual properties.

Definition
ChEBI: 3,5-dichloro-N-(1-chloro-3-methyl-2-oxopentan-3-yl)-4-methylbenzamide is a member of the class of benzamides obtained by formal condensation of the carboxy group of 3,5-dichloro-4-methylbenzamide with the amino group of 3-amino-1-chloro-3-methylpentan-2-one. It is a member of benzamides, an alpha-chloroketone and a dichlorobenzene.
Hazard
Low toxicity by ingestion, inhalation, and skin contact.
Properties of ZOXAMIDE
| Melting point: | 158-160°; mp 159.5-160.5° (Egan) |
| Boiling point: | 415.4±45.0 °C(Predicted) |
| Density | 1.289±0.06 g/cm3(Predicted) |
| storage temp. | 0-6°C |
| pka | 11.20±0.46(Predicted) |
| form | neat |
| BRN | 11413911 |
| EPA Substance Registry System | Zoxamide (156052-68-5) |
Safety information for ZOXAMIDE
| Signal word | Warning |
| Pictogram(s) |
![]() Exclamation Mark Irritant GHS07 ![]() Environment GHS09 |
| GHS Hazard Statements |
H317:Sensitisation, Skin H410:Hazardous to the aquatic environment, long-term hazard |
| Precautionary Statement Codes |
P261:Avoid breathing dust/fume/gas/mist/vapours/spray. P272:Contaminated work clothing should not be allowed out of the workplace. P273:Avoid release to the environment. P280:Wear protective gloves/protective clothing/eye protection/face protection. P302+P352:IF ON SKIN: wash with plenty of soap and water. P333+P313:IF SKIN irritation or rash occurs: Get medical advice/attention. |
